What is Destiny 2 DIM? A Deep Dive
Destiny Item Manager, or DIM, is a free, third-party web application designed to streamline inventory management within Destiny 2. It allows players to seamlessly transfer items between characters, the Vault, and even loadouts, all from a single, intuitive interface. Unlike the in-game system, DIM offers advanced search, filtering, and organizational tools, making it easy to find exactly what you need, when you need it. Think of it as your personal, highly efficient armory manager.
DIM’s origins trace back to the early days of Destiny 1, where the need for better inventory management was immediately apparent. Over time, it has evolved into a sophisticated tool, constantly updated to reflect changes in Destiny 2 and incorporate user feedback. Its underlying principles are simple: accessibility, efficiency, and comprehensive control over your Destiny 2 inventory.
At its core, DIM operates by connecting to your Bungie.net account, granting it secure access to your Destiny 2 characters and Vault. It then presents this information in a user-friendly interface, allowing you to manipulate your inventory with ease. Advanced features like loadout optimization, perk identification, and stat analysis further enhance its capabilities.
Recent updates have integrated features like wish list support, allowing you to quickly identify and acquire items recommended by the community. DIM’s continued development ensures it remains a vital tool for any serious Destiny 2 player.

Detailed Features of Destiny 2 DIM: A Comprehensive Overview
DIM boasts a wide array of features designed to streamline inventory management and enhance your Destiny 2 experience. Let’s explore some of the most notable:
1. Drag-and-Drop Interface
DIM’s intuitive drag-and-drop interface allows you to easily move items between your characters, Vault, and loadouts. Simply click and drag an item to its desired location. This eliminates the need to navigate through multiple menus and screens, as required by the in-game system. 2. Advanced Search and Filtering
Quickly find specific items using DIM’s powerful search and filtering options. Search by name, perk, stat, or even specific mod. Filter items by rarity, type, or energy type. The benefit is the ability to locate exactly what you need, even within a cluttered Vault. 3. Loadout Optimizer
Create and save custom loadouts for different activities. Name your loadouts, assign weapons, armor, and mods, and then equip everything with a single click. This is invaluable for quickly switching between PvE and PvP setups, or for optimizing your gear for specific raid encounters. 4. Perk Identification
DIM automatically identifies the perks on your weapons and armor, displaying them in a clear and concise manner. This eliminates the need to inspect each item individually to determine its perks. The benefit is a quick and easy way to assess the value of your gear. For example, DIM can instantly highlight weapons with god-roll perks, allowing you to prioritize them.
5. Stat Analysis
View detailed stat breakdowns for your characters and gear. DIM calculates your total Resilience, Recovery, Discipline, Intellect, Strength, and Mobility, allowing you to optimize your builds for maximum effectiveness. The user benefit is a deeper understanding of your character’s capabilities and the ability to fine-tune your stats for specific playstyles. 7. Tagging System
DIM’s tagging system allows you to categorize and label your items for easy organization. Tag items as “Keep,” “Junk,” or create custom tags to suit your needs. This is particularly useful for managing a large Vault and identifying items that you want to keep or dismantle. The benefit is a more organized and efficient inventory management system.

Cons/Limitations
* **Requires Bungie.net Account:** DIM requires access to your Bungie.net account, which may be a concern for some users (though it uses secure authentication).
* **Third-Party Application:** As a third-party application, DIM is not officially supported by Bungie.
* **Occasional Downtime:** DIM may experience occasional downtime due to server maintenance or updates.
* **Reliance on Internet Connection:** DIM requires a stable internet connection to function properly.

Key Alternatives
* **Ishtar Commander:** Another popular Destiny 2 inventory management tool, offering similar features to DIM. Ishtar Commander is primarily a mobile app.
* **The Official Destiny 2 Companion App:** While the official app offers some inventory management features, it is not as comprehensive or efficient as DIM.

Q1: Is Destiny 2 DIM safe to use with my Bungie.net account?
DIM utilizes the official Bungie.net API for secure access to your account. It does not store your login credentials and uses industry-standard security protocols. Millions of players use DIM without issue, but it’s always wise to use strong, unique passwords.
Q2: Can I use DIM on my mobile device?
Yes, DIM is a web application and can be accessed from any device with a web browser, including smartphones and tablets. The interface is responsive and adapts to different screen sizes.
Q3: How do I import wish lists into DIM?
DIM allows you to import wish lists from various sources, such as d2armory.com. Simply copy the wish list URL and paste it into DIM’s wish list import tool.
Q4: Can I transfer items while in an activity?
Yes, you can transfer items while in most activities. However, it is generally not recommended to do so during high-stakes activities like raids or Trials of Osiris, as it may cause disconnects or other issues.
Q5: How do I create and save loadouts in DIM?
To create a loadout, equip your desired weapons, armor, and mods on your character. Then, click the “Save Loadout” button and give your loadout a name. You can then equip the entire loadout with a single click.
Q6: What are the different tagging options in DIM?
DIM allows you to tag items as “Keep,” “Junk,” or create custom tags to suit your needs. This helps you organize your Vault and identify items that you want to keep or dismantle.
Q7: How does DIM calculate my character’s stats?
DIM calculates your character’s stats by adding up the stat bonuses from your armor, mods, and subclasses. It then displays your total Resilience, Recovery, Discipline, Intellect, Strength, and Mobility.
Q8: Does DIM support cross-save?
Yes, DIM supports cross-save. It will automatically detect your linked accounts and allow you to manage your inventory across all platforms.
